What is an entry level computer information systems job?

Entry level computer information systems jobs are positions designed for individuals who are new to the field of IT and information systems. These roles typically involve tasks such as troubleshooting computer issues, supporting network infrastructure, assisting with database management, and maintaining software applications. Entry level positions often include titles like IT support specialist, help desk technician, or junior systems analyst. They provide foundational experience and a pathway to more advanced roles in technology. Most positions require at least an associate's or bachelor's degree in computer information systems or a related field.

What types of projects or tasks can I expect to work on as an entry level computer information systems professional?

As an Entry Level Computer Information Systems professional, you can expect to handle a variety of tasks such as assisting with system upgrades, troubleshooting basic hardware and software issues, supporting end users, and maintaining databases. You'll often collaborate with team members in IT support, network administration, or software development, depending on your organization's structure. This role provides exposure to different aspects of information systems, giving you valuable experience that can help you specialize or advance into higher-level positions as you build your sk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level computer information systems profess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Computer Information Systems professional, you need a solid understanding of information technology fundamentals, basic programming, and database management, often supported by a relevant degree or coursework. Familiarity with tools like SQL, Microsoft Office Suite, and introductory knowledge of network or ERP systems is common.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set candidates apart in this role. These skills are essential for efficiently supporting IT operations, troubleshooting issues, and collaborating with technical and non-technical stakeholders.

What is the difference between Entry Level Computer Information Systems vs Network Technician?

AspectEntry Level Computer Information SystemsNetwork Technician
CredentialsAssociate's degree or relevant certifications (e.g., CompTIA A+)Associate's degree or certifications (e.g., CompTIA Network+)
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, IT departments, support rolesNetwork labs, client sites, troubleshooting environments
Industry UsageBroad IT support, systems managementNetwork infrastructure setup and maintenance
Common Search IntentEntry level IT roles, support technician jobsNetwork troubleshooting, infrastructure roles

Entry Level Computer Information Systems roles focus on general IT support, systems management, and user support, often requiring broad technical knowledge. Network Technicians specialize in network infrastructure, troubleshooting, and maintenance, with a focus on networking hardware and protocols. Both roles often require similar certifications but differ in daily tasks and work environments.

Job description

Overview

This position supports the company’s efforts in analyzing capital markets, tracking origination activity, supporting mortgage pricing operations, and purchasing assets through the correspondent bulk mandatory desk. The analyst role will also be responsible for communicating capital markets initiatives to other functional business groups.

This position will be based in our office located on Morehead Square Drive in Charlotte, NC, and will require attendance five days per week. We offer a competitive salary, an annual bonus, a 401(k) company match, and comprehensive medical benefits starting on day one. 


Responsibilities
  • Prepare and publish pricing rate sheets for all mortgage origination channels
  • Coordinate with external pricing engines to validate pricing on client portals
  • Participate in seller auctions to acquire mortgage assets through the Bulk Mandatory Desk
  • Analyze pricing trends and bond performance in mortgage capital markets, then strategize pricing enhancements based on the current market environment
  • Aggregate data and analyze origination activity to optimize volume and profitability
  • Develop operational efficiencies to enhance business process performance
  • Communicate Capital Markets initiatives to other internal business groups to promote transparency throughout the organization
  • Perform ad hoc analytical requests and research projects for internal business groups
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of product guidelines, industry trends, and events
  • Other duties as assigned

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ree related to Business, Economics, Data Analytics, or Computer Information Systems preferred
  • 0-1 year of relevant experience in the capital markets or financial services industry
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Excellent organizational and time management skills
  • Strong attention to detail
  • Proficient with Microsoft Office Excel
  • Programming and Data Visualization skills preferred (VBA, SQL, R, Tableau, Power BI, CAS)
